Today we are chatting about the wild world of breastfeeding advice on social media.
Let me tell you, it's a jungle out there!
We were getting pretty frustrated with all the bogus info floating around and how hard it is to set the record straight for our clients.
It's super important to seek out reliable sources of information and to be careful about how much you let social media influence your beliefs and decisions.
That's why in this episode, we are stressing the importance of critical thinking and skepticism when we're bombarded with too much info.
“Just follow the money and you will find where all this information, quote-unquote, is coming from.”

About Us
Leah Jolly is a private practice IBCLC with Bay Area Breastfeeding in Houston, Texas.
Annie Frisbie is a private practice IBCLC serving Queens and Brooklyn in New York City and the creator of the Lactation Consultant Private Practice Toolkit.
